| description abstract | In the design of roof and wall double-diagonal cross bracing, the compression diagonal is usually ignored. The possibility of bracing provided to the compression diagonal by the loaded tension diagonal is examined. It is shown that the compression diagonal may be effectively braced at midspan through its connection to the tension diagonal, thereby increasing the total capacity of the double-diagonal cross bracing system. | |
